Procedure detail
This patient goes back a few years with us. Prior to our intervention, he had undergone a few treatments in the late 80’s & early 90’s with an outside provider that was using standard punch grafts and mini grafts at the time.As evidenced by the photos, his result was not natural, the hairline being pluggy and too vertical in orientation. He also had open donor areas as well as wide strip scars on the right and left sides.Dr. True initially did two mini-strip sessions - smaller due to the extensive scarring from the previous surgeries elsewhere. At the same time, FUE was used to to thin the punch grafts. 2708 grafts were place into the interior of the hairline and central front/top.Dr. True then made the necessary transition to pure FUE harvesting with focus on softening the hairline edge and adding to the forelock region. Hair was also added to the donor area to improve the strip scars from the treatments the patient had before us. Ultimately 2 FUE sessions totaling 1674 grafts were performed. Overall, @8300 hairs were transplanted to achieve a more acceptable and natural appearance for this patient.
